Armed and Agile: Chinese Robotera L7 Robot Demonstrates Impressive Sword Skills

Chinese engineering has reached a new milestone as a humanoid robot demonstrates remarkable sword-fighting abilities, showcasing advanced motor skills and agility that push the boundaries of robotics.

The Sword-Wielding Robot

In a demonstration that marks a significant advancement in robotics, the Robotera L7 humanoid robot, nicknamed “Linghu Chong” after a fictional swordsman, has been showcased wielding a sword with impressive dexterity. The robot performed complex martial arts movements including thrusts, kick flips, and slashes with remarkable precision, demonstrating capabilities far beyond what most humanoid robots have achieved to date.

Technical Capabilities

The Robotera L7 boasts impressive technical specifications that enable its fluid movements:

  • 55 degrees of freedom overall
  • 7 degrees of freedom in each arm
  • 12 degrees of freedom in each hand

While these specifications are impressive, they still fall short of the human hand’s estimated 27 degrees of freedom, suggesting humans maintain a theoretical advantage in dexterity.

Development and Background

The L7 robot was first unveiled in July 2025 with support from Tsinghua University. Initially, Robotera highlighted the robot’s agility through breakdancing demonstrations and showcased its practical applications in commercial settings.

The recent sword demonstration was timed to coincide with Chinese New Year celebrations, with the robot’s sword being called the “Dugu Nine Swords” – a reference to a fictional fighting technique from Chinese literature.

Significance

This demonstration represents more than just an entertaining display. It signals China’s growing prominence in advanced robotics and automation. The L7’s ability to execute complex, full-body movements in rapid succession while handling a weapon demonstrates significant progress in robotic motor control, balance, and coordination.

While the demonstration was primarily for entertainment and marketing purposes, the underlying technology advances could have applications in various fields requiring precise robotic movements.
